What reason is dizziness after drinking tea?

First: nervous system diseases: such as cerebral ischemia, cerebellar lesions, brain lesions, brain trauma, some types of epilepsy, etc. In addition, patients with autonomic nerve dysfunction and some neurosis often feel dizzy.

Second: medical diseases: such as hypertension, hypotension, various cardiovascular and cerebrovascular diseases, anemia, infection, poisoning, hypoglycemia, etc. Sometimes a cold may be accompanied by dizziness.

Third: cervical vertebra bone degeneration: due to long-term posture or poor sleeping posture, cervical vertebra hyperplasia, deformation, degeneration, neck muscle tension, arterial blood supply obstruction, brain blood supply insufficiency, is the main cause of dizziness, neck tightness, limited flexibility, occasional pain, numbness, chills, heavy feeling.
